Experience the rich cultural tradition that celebrates the preparation, serving and drinking of powdered green tea or matcha. Your host, attired in kimono and trained in the omotosenkestyle of tea ceremony, will demonstrate how to clean special utensils and present the matcha, as well as how to receive and drink tea in keeping with ancient Japanese customs.
